Our Endodontics MSc is designed to give you the skills to successfully and confidently manage more complex and demanding endodontic cases. We will provide the latest evidence based knowledge in endodontology enabling you to successfully integrate endodontic therapy with other aspects of restorative dentistry, and learn research methodology
This course is mostly delivered online, so you can study anywhere in the world with minimum disruption to your professional and personal life while benefitting from world-class teaching.

Course programme
Required Modules
- Clinical Skills (20 credits)
- Anatomy of Pulpal Dentinal Complex & Periodontium (20 credits)
- Research Methods (20 credits)
- Face-to-face training block

2nd Year
- Pulpal & Periapical Inflammation (20 credits)
- Diagnostic Procedures (20 credits)
- Operative Procedures (20 credits)
- Face-to-face training block

3rd Year
- Endodontic Retreatment/Surgery & Restoration of Endodontically Treated Teeth (20 credits)
- Project (40 credits)
